Cash‑Out Flexibility
Here is the deal: cash‑out isn’t just a button, it’s a negotiation. Some platforms present a static percentage—take it or leave it. Others calculate a dynamic value based on live probability, your stake, and the remaining time. The smarter ones even let you set a minimum cash‑out threshold, protecting you from a last‑second dip. And here is why it matters: a poorly timed cash‑out can erase a winning position, while a well‑timed one can lock in profit before a sudden swing. The best sites give you a slider, a graph, maybe even an AI‑driven suggestion that feels like a personal betting coach.
Interface Speed and Latency
Interface latency is the silent assassin. A cluttered UI, flashing ads, or a laggy websocket will make you miss a key moment. Some newcomers tout “ultra‑low latency” by hosting servers in close proximity to betting exchanges, shaving off milliseconds that matter in a ten‑second goal scenario. Look: a crisp, colour‑coded feed that highlights live events in real time can be the difference between cashing out at £120 or settling for £95. The bottom line? Test the site on both desktop and mobile, throw a few rapid bets, and gauge the delay before you trust your bankroll.
Regulatory Safeguards
Never forget the legal backdrop. The UK Gambling Commission cracks down on sites that don’t enforce responsible gambling tools in live betting. A compliant platform will embed limits for deposit, loss, and session time directly into the live betting screen. By the way, the presence of an “auto‑pause” feature when odds shift beyond a preset volatility threshold shows a site that respects its players. If you can’t spot these protections, you’re probably looking at a rogue operation that could vanish with your winnings.
